Peng Fang is a scholar working on Cognitive Neuroscience, Radiology, Nuclear Medicine and Imaging and Experimental and Cognitive Psychology. According to data from OpenAlex, Peng Fang has authored 71 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 40 papers in Cognitive Neuroscience, 23 papers in Radiology, Nuclear Medicine and Imaging and 17 papers in Experimental and Cognitive Psychology. Recurrent topics in Peng Fang’s work include Functional Brain Connectivity Studies (31 papers), Advanced Neuroimaging Techniques and Applications (21 papers) and Transcranial Magnetic Stimulation Studies (12 papers). Peng Fang is often cited by papers focused on Functional Brain Connectivity Studies (31 papers), Advanced Neuroimaging Techniques and Applications (21 papers) and Transcranial Magnetic Stimulation Studies (12 papers). Peng Fang collaborates with scholars based in China, United States and Australia. Peng Fang's co-authors include Dewen Hu, Hui Shen, Ling‐Li Zeng, Lubin Wang, Baojuan Li, Yaming Li, Li Liu, Zongtan Zhou, Nana Jiao and Liqin Xie and has published in prestigious journals such as PLoS ONE, NeuroImage and Brain.
